Linse collaborates with emerging and mid-generation Argentine artists who construct their own imaginative worlds, where performativity plays a crucial role. The gallery encourages dialogue with the context through its artistic memory, encompassing political and cultural history, gender, the body, nature, economy, and fiction as tools to construct possible realms. Linse operates as a platform that supports and fosters artistic developments, grounded in constant dialogue, with the aim of contributing to the insertion of Argentine artists into both the national and international art scene.
